    Criminal Defense Lawyers in Carteret County, NC

    Criminal defense lawyers represent clients at every stage of a criminal case: investigation, arrest, arraignment, plea bargaining, trial, and appeal. They assess evidence, protect constitutional rights, negotiate reduced charges or sentences, cross-examine witnesses, raise defenses, file motions, and advocate to minimize penalties or obtain acquittals.
